Football Insider report that Arsenal are in advanced talks with Brighton and Hove Albion to sign Mat Ryan on a permanent deal this summer. Ryan joined on loan in January, but without an option to buy in the contract.

Though the 29-year-old’s two Gunners appearances haven’t gone as planned since then, there was little he could do about either of the goals he conceded. Mikel Arteta is clearly happy with the Australia international in training.

Transfer talks are reportedly “expected to be finalised”, progressing well at this stage. Given Ryan only has a year left on his contract, it would cost significantly less than £10m January asking price to complete the deal, according to the same report.

A boyhood Arsenal fan, Ryan is understandably keen to complete the move, even if he does face a bit of a battle with Bernd Leno to start matches. If the price is right, it would be a nice easy piece of business to do to start the summer.
